What MERV means and why it matters
In the context of air filtration, the term air filter merv meaning refers to the MERV rating, a standardized scale that measures a filter’s ability to capture airborne particles. This single number helps homeowners compare performance across brands and models. According to Air Filter Zone, understanding MERV means balancing indoor air quality with system airflow and energy use. A higher MERV rating generally captures smaller particles, improving cleanliness and allergen control, but it can increase resistance to airflow. That resistance may require more fan effort or reduce the air that circulates through your spaces. When choosing a filter, start with the best fit your equipment can handle and your air quality goals, then adjust as needed based on comfort and energy considerations. How MERV ratings are determined
MERV ratings are derived from standardized tests that measure filtration efficiency across particle sizes. Manufacturers expose a sample filter to test dust and count what passes through at typical operating conditions. The result is a single number that reflects performance across a broad particle spectrum, not just one particle size. This approach helps consumers compare filters without lab equipment. The rating does not guarantee real world results, because it depends on installation, airflow, and maintenance. The MERV system is widely adopted in HVAC and indoor air quality discussions, making it easier to assess filtration capabilities. Common MERV ranges and their typical uses
- MERV 1-4: Basic filtration for large dust and lint, limited impact on indoor allergens. Suitable for older systems with low airflow resistance.
- MERV 5-8: General filtration for households with average air quality. Balances filtration with reasonable airflow in most residential systems.
- MERV 9-12: Higher efficiency for common indoor pollutants like dust, pollen, and some smoke particles. Often recommended for allergy-conscious homes with decent HVAC capacity.
- MERV 13-16: High efficiency for fine particulates, including smoke and fine dust. Best for well-sealed homes or occupants with significant allergy concerns, provided the system can handle the airflow resistance.
How to choose the right MERV for your system
Begin by checking your HVAC equipment manufacturer’s guidance on compatible MERV ranges. Consider your indoor air quality goals—are allergies a concern, or do you simply want cleaner air? Assess your system’s airflow capacity and filter pressure drop; a high MERV filter should not unduly strain the blower. Start with a midrange option and monitor comfort, airflow, and energy use. MERV vs MPR and other rating systems
MERV is the widely recognized rating on a universal scale for building filtration efficacy. Some brands use proprietary scales such as MPR or FPR that focus on specific particle targets or brand technologies. When comparing, don’t rely on a single number; read the product sheet for particle size capture ranges and pressure drop. Using multiple references helps you pick a filter that fits both your air quality goals and your HVAC’s airflow characteristics.
Impact on airflow, energy use, and comfort
Higher MERV filters generally offer better particle removal but add more resistance to airflow. This can lead to a marginal increase in energy use or reduced air output if the system isn’t designed for it. In homes with robust HVAC fans and good duct design, high MERV filters can be practical. In older or tighter systems, a midrange MERV might deliver the best balance between clean air and comfortable airflow. Regular checkups and proper installation help maintain performance.
Maintenance and replacement timing
Maintenance quality is as important as the MERV rating itself. Inspect filters regularly and replace when they appear dirty, even if the calendar says otherwise. In dusty environments or during allergy seasons, more frequent changes are recommended. Avoid running a dirty filter, as it punishes airflow and can reduce indoor air quality over time. Establish a routine aligned with your environment and lifestyle.

What is MERV and why should I care about air filter merv meaning?
MERV stands for Minimum Efficiency Reporting Value. It rates a filter’s ability to trap particles of various sizes. Knowing the MERV meaning helps you compare filters and choose one that fits your air quality goals and HVAC capabilities.

Is a higher MERV always better?
Not necessarily. Higher MERV filters capture more particles but can restrict airflow if your system isn’t designed for them. Balance filtration with the HVAC’s airflow capability.

Can I use MERV rated filters in a car?
MERV filters are designed for home HVAC systems. Car filtration often uses different standards and should use filters rated for automotive use as specified by the vehicle manufacturer.
